hello there Sumit here... I'm facing strange problem here... Recently i Bought AMD A10 6800k APU and i'm facing Over heating issue... processer heats up 90c in ideal stage... when i used it for games or anything else it heats up to 109c... temperatures are as per HW Moniter...

Previously i was using AMD A4 4000 with 400W VIP SMPS... now i changed my smps and bought Antec VP550W smps stil processer is heating... shopkeeper says your smps having Voltage drop issue bt iss work perfect on my friends pc... plz help me out...

My Pc Config...

Pc Case - Antec X1
PSU - Antec VP550 W
Motherboard - GA-F2A55M-DS2
Processer - AMD A10 6800k
Ram - Kingston HyperX Blue 4GB

when you got the new processor did you clean off the heatsink? or did you put too much thermal compound? or none at all? honestly i dont believe its a power supply issue thats causing the heat.
